Tour Overview
The ice fishing tour in Akureyri offers participants the chance to experience the unique winter activity of ice fishing on Ljósavatn Lake.
The 3.5-hour tour departs from Akureyri and includes a scenic 30-minute drive each way.
Once at the lake, guests will receive guided assistance from experts as they try their hand at ice fishing.
Hot cocoa and refreshments are provided, and participants can learn about Iceland’s history and culture throughout the experience.
Priced from $130.51 per person, the tour is available in English and features free cancellation up to 24 hours in advance.

Itinerary Details
The tour departs from Akureyri, with participants enjoying a scenic 30-minute drive each way to reach Ljósavatn Lake.
A scenic 30-minute drive from Akureyri takes participants to Ljósavatn Lake, the starting point of the ice fishing tour.
Once on the lake, guests will have 2.5 hours to ice fish under the guidance of expert instructors. The tour provides all necessary equipment, including fishing rods and hot cocoa to warm up during the experience.
After the fishing, the group will return to Akureyri. Throughout the trip, participants can learn about Iceland’s history and culture from the knowledgeable guide.
The tour includes roundtrip transportation and a fishing license.

Insider Tips for Ice Fishing
For a successful ice fishing experience at Ljósavatn Lake, visitors should keep a few key tips in mind.
-
Dress in warm, waterproof layers to combat the chilly temperatures on the frozen lake. Thick socks, insulated boots, and a windbreaker are essentials.
-
Bring a small stool or seat pad to sit comfortably while fishing. The ice can be hard and unforgiving.
-
Pack a thermos of hot coffee or tea to sip throughout the excursion. The warm beverage will help stave off the cold.
-
Familiarize yourself with ice safety and drilling techniques to ensure a safe and productive fishing session.
